§ 71-8720 — Public disclosure of data and information
Nebraska·Ch. 71 Public Health and Welfare
A patient safety organization shall release to the public nonidentifiable aggregate trend data identifying the number and types of patient safety events that occur. A patient safety organization shall publish educational and evidence-based information from the summary reports, which shall be available to the public, that can be used by all providers to improve the care they provide.
